主页 > 互联网 > lol比赛下注平台:详解Serverless服务,它会颠覆你对云的理解|硬创公开课

lol比赛下注平台:详解Serverless服务,它会颠覆你对云的理解|硬创公开课

lol比赛下注平台 互联网 2021年09月01日
本文摘要:Lambda反对所有数据的访问控制。Aurora是AWS与第三方模块相容的关系数据库服务,现在还处于预览阶段。它之所以经常出现,是因为传统的数据库解决方案并不是为云平台设计的,而是要用云思维新的定义。AWS引进了SOA理念,创建了新的数据库引擎,将传统的数据组件分解为独立的国家模块,通过自己的云平台上已经有的服务构建了这些服务模块。 这使得用户不必担心数据库的升级,容量扩大这些令人困惑的问题。

lol比赛下注平台

Lambda反对所有数据的访问控制。Aurora是AWS与第三方模块相容的关系数据库服务,现在还处于预览阶段。它之所以经常出现,是因为传统的数据库解决方案并不是为云平台设计的,而是要用云思维新的定义。AWS引进了SOA理念,创建了新的数据库引擎,将传统的数据组件分解为独立的国家模块,通过自己的云平台上已经有的服务构建了这些服务模块。

这使得用户不必担心数据库的升级,容量扩大这些令人困惑的问题。如上图所示,整个数据库服务分为数据层和控制层,控制层由DynamoDB保存元数据,Routebook53获得服务,SWF负责SOA管理中的工作协议。

数据层用于可靠性高的S3构筑数据的高能量存储。AWS通过共享存储也构建了读取分离和高可用性,可以满足大多数用户对数据库的拒绝。

Aurora的价格与开源数据库的价格完全相似,只是高端商业数据库价格的十分之一。右图是Aurora(蓝色)和MySQL(蓝色和红色)数据库在读取方面的性能总的来说,从经济成本、管理成本和实际效用来看,它们打破了传统数据库。

Serverless设计模式经典的3层网络应用于典型的网络,一般分为动态和静态资源。在设计中,可以使用S3作为静态资源的存储,同时使用CloudFront的CDN加快服务。动态这个DynamoDB作为网站的数据存储,通过APIGateway和Lambda构前端的静态页面调度。整个结构使用Serverless服务。

您还可以设计更简单的结构。静态部分是S3和CloudFront,但是添加了高级功能。动态部分在重新加入IAM反对的同时,在API、Gateway这个层面重新加入了流量控制、证明书等。

还可以重新加入防火墙服务WAF。但是,Serverless结构的组件太多,如果API有几十个或几百个节点,Lambda函数也不太多,手动管理不太方便。因此,亚马逊也推出了适当的方案SAM。

如下图所示:AWSCloudFormation是亚马逊专门提供和管理计算资源的服务,SAM是其子集,可以包装整个结构设计,自动包装一切,自动化。数据批处理许多数据批处理的逻辑可以分解为Map-Reduce的合理操作者。

但是,亚马逊Lambda获得的想法是,将原始数据不存在云,定义filter(将输出的数据分配给多个maper),maper(继续执行同构逻辑,同构结果不存在DynamoDB),reducer(处理同构逻辑,最后结果不存在S3)3个lambda函数。由于S3和DynamoDB的事件时Lambda函数继续执行,因此整个过程几乎可以自动完成和自动前端。

另外,起点和起点都是S3,可以串联多个Map-Reduce逻辑,包括更简单的处理模型。数据流处理Kinesis是亚马逊处理流数据的品牌。右图是简化版和S3和Lambda数据流两步汇集的处理系统。

lol比赛下注平台

第一步是用Lambda构建可行性处理器Stream的Processor,处理流程数据后,将结果留在S3上。第二,在CloudWatch定时器功能周期启动时,Lambda函数将进一步处理中间结果,最终结果不存在于S3。

为了提高效率,第二步的Lambda是任务分配器,在同时启动时可以明确处理数据的Lambda函数,同时处理多个S3的中间结果对象。这里有Lambda和Kinesis构建方案的技术差异的危险。当两者接入时,前者的分段能力不会被后者的分段能力所允许。同时运营的StreamProcessor的数量达不到Kinesis的数据流分配的数据,不会积累数据流。

解决问题的方法是,如果瓶颈是访问Kinesis的Lambda函数,则可以延长函数的继续执行时间。明确地说,Lambda函数不负责管理明确的数据处理,必须对Lambda进行并行处理。

从Lambda函数开始时,其他Lambda函数没有分段允许,因此可以立即处理Kinesis的数据。Serverless的优缺点已经提到了其优点,现在就其问题和挑战进行说明。一般来说,传统开发的技术和经验不限。

首先,服务细粒度减少了开发大型应用程序的可玩性。传统的网站应用于可以管理成百上千的API,但在Serverless中,开发人员必须有足够的管理能力来应对。其次,Serverless不能与云制造商反对的特定技术栈相结合,允许代码的不道德。创造当地研究开发环境更加困难,调便。

现在有人在当地使用Docker模拟运营环境,这有点中举,但几乎不像生产环境。应用于安全性模型过于成熟期,如何构建加密、证书、权限管理都需要时间检查。Serverless的意义对于研发工程师来说,Serverless是一个新的职业发展机会。

它乎取代了现有的传统研发和配置模式,但一定会在某个领域大放异彩。它还降低了研发低应用的门槛,可以构建低可扩展性和高可用性。对于运输技术人员来说,可以更准确地认识到云计算时代系统运输这一职业的危机。

lol比赛下注平台

云计算的发展趋势之一是云制造商将自己在结构和运输实践中的经验产品化,获得用户,其共同特征是运输的依赖更小,研发工程师可以独立国家完成系统配置。但是,该职业的发展方向是考虑研究开发,实现运输自动化。Serverless也为希望向自动运输方向变革的工程师获得了职业发展机会,利用Serverless的新运输逻辑,完成了运输自动化。

对于CTO和架构师来说,Serverless有助于解读新的架构设计构想,系统架构的一部分由Serverless构筑,获得研究开发和运输效率,以低成本构筑可扩展性和可用性。对于CEO和产品经理来说,解读Serverless有助于区分某个产品特性是否适合这个服务。对学生来说,自学改版的科学知识总结,自学Serverless有助于解读新的软件设计模式,为了自己的职业发展,Serverless代表新的软件设计模式,必须以新的想法来看云计算,已经政治宣传了云的解读。原始文章允许禁止发布。

下一篇文章发表了注意事项。


本文关键词:lol,比赛,下注,平台,详解,Serverless,服务,它会,lol比赛下注平台

本文来源:lol比赛下注平台-www.krishnamagazine.com

标签: 服务   下注   它会   Serverless   比赛   详解   平台   lol